WWF Launches Gift Catalog On Facebook
Tuesday, October 26, 2010, 16:50:44 GMT by Mike Sachoff
The World Wildlife Fund )WWF( has launched what it calls the first, nonprofit gift catalog on Facebook today. WWF's Gift Center on Facebook allows users to make a donation and pick a symbolic animal adoption from a list of more than 100 animals. Animal adoptions and all other items from the gift catalog, are connected to Facebook's Like and Share features, allowing users to create virtual wish lists.

eBay Partners With Groupon On Daily Deals
Monday, October 25, 2010, 15:22:32 GMT by Mike Sachoff
eBay has partnered with social shopping website Groupon, to offer daily deals from Groupon throughout its site. Members of the eBay Bucks Rewards Program who purchase Groupon deals from the eBay site earn 5% of the purchase price back in eBay Bucks. Groupon is available in more than 100 North American markets and offers nearly 200 deals per day; eBay will use geolocation to find the closest deal for each user.

PBS Introduces New Website
Monday, October 25, 2010, 14:04:51 GMT by Mike Sachoff
PBS has introduced a beta version of a new PBS.org with a focus on local content from member stations, full TV episodes and auto-localization features. The new PBS.org features member station and partner content along with national productions as part of the home page, topic pages, special features and series sites. PBS.org is automatically localized so visitors can view video, TV schedule information and content that is specific to their community.

Consumer Reports Introduces iPhone App
Monday, October 18, 2010, 19:16:14 GMT by Mike Sachoff
Consumer Reports has introduced a new app for iPhone users,which provides access to ratings, recommendations, brand reliability, and buying advice for appliances, electronics, children's products, car care, and home products. The app, called Consumer Reports Mobile Shopper, is available for download for $9.99 The app allows users to research purchases by scanning the UPC barcode; searching for the make and model; or browsing through Consumer Reports expert Ratings.

Yahoo Partners With Ram Truck On Country Music Site
Friday, October 15, 2010, 16:57:09 GMT by Mike Sachoff
Yahoo has partnered with Ram Truck on branded country music site called Ram Country on Yahoo Music. Its the first time Yahoo Music has launched a dedicated country music site. Ram Country is aimed at helping Ram Tuck reach country music fans online and is the largest online marketing initiative for the brand. The new site will feature a mix of music, blogs, news coverage, and original video programming produced by Yahoo.

New York Times Launches Full Content For iPad App
Friday, October 15, 2010, 15:50:08 GMT by Mike Sachoff
The New York Times today introduced its NYTimes App for iPad, which replaces its Editors' Choice App. The new app has more than 25 sections of Times content, including more videos and photos; breaking news alerts; and improved section and article navigation. The NYTimes is free for now and available in the App Store, but that will change when the Times launches its pay model next year, requring an iPad app subscription.
